Analyzing The Algorithm of Sentiment – A Mental & Computational Science Convergence
The fascinating intersection where psychology and computer science are converging is yielding intriguing insights into the essence of human emotion. Researchers are increasingly attempting to simulate emotional responses, not just as raw data points, but as complex sequences involving appraisal, physiological reactions, and behavioral manifestations. This endeavor, often dubbed "the algorithm of emotion," utilizes techniques from machine learning, natural language processing, and affective computing to understand facial cues, vocal intonation, and textual language to assess emotional conditions. While replicating the full depth and uniqueness of human feeling remains a major challenge, these efforts hold promise for breakthroughs in fields ranging from psychological health assessment to adaptive artificial intelligence.
Tech & Trauma Supporting Ladies' Mental Wellbeing
The rapidly expanding digital landscape, while offering incredible benefits, presents distinct challenges to women's mental wellbeing. Exposure to online harassment, cyberbullying, unrealistic beauty standards perpetuated by social media, and the constant pressure to be “available” can contribute to feelings of anxiety, depression, and seriously trauma. It’s vital that we develop approaches to lessen these risks and foster a more encouraging online environment for women, including providing access to accessible mental health resources and promoting digital literacy abilities that empower them to navigate these complexities with increased resilience and understanding. Furthermore, drawing attention to awareness among social media platforms about their role in protecting users' emotional safety is paramount to establishing a healthier digital future for all.

Mitigating Frontend Fatigue: Helping Women Developers
The rapid evolution of frontend coding presents a particular challenge, and women in the field are disproportionately encountering "frontend fatigue"—a form of burnout characterized by feelings of overwhelm, demotivation, and a decrease of joy in their work. This isn’t just about handling the latest tool; it’s often intertwined with implicit biases, imposter syndrome, and the demand to constantly learn new technologies. Fostering supportive environments, promoting a balance between work and life integration, and openly acknowledging these complex issues are critical to ensuring the flourishing and retention of women in frontend roles. A proactive approach is required to inspire resilience and reignite the excitement for building beautiful web experiences.
